
While Los Angeles and Anaheim prepare for Game 7 of their second-round series, the Chicago Blackhawks are resting and looking for ways they can play even better in the Western Conference final. The Blackhawks practiced Thursday without ailing center Andrew Shaw, but Brandon Bollig skated on the fourth line after he was suspended for the final two games of their second-round series against Minnesota. ''We expect to have him back on the ice this weekend and we'll get a better determination of when he'll play,'' coach Joel Quenneville said. The Blackhawks missed Shaw's net-front presence and pesky style in their six-game victory over Minnesota.
